
Figure 6.3 - Preliminary study |
Figure 6.3 is a study explaining how linear engine torque can be generated using two blades per rotor.
As the torque value is defined by « M = F * r » and « F » depends on « P » pressure, the torque is linearised by pressure management
Valves are used for pressure management.
|

Figure 6.4 - Study including tilting times |
In Figure 6.4, pressure buildup time and release time are expressed by « π + 2π / n », tilting time of the stops is expressed by « π - 2π / n ».
The variable « n » is the value of the divisor in this case
